Virginia Alice Braddock 1949-2018

She was an SDS Radical from the 60’s.
She advocated ‘for’ things, as opposed to advocating ‘against’ things.
It led to a life of intrigue, mystery, and major serial dramas.
She died quietly, in her sleep, in New York City, September 22nd.
She was creamated, and her ashes are in Lakewood Cemetary, in The Braddock Family Plot in Section 24, Site 115.
She is deeply missed by her friends and family.
